Transaction 57a74b3bd2c431f89c65d30dab8a51df3d8ce5103bce7b70c04ecdcd424f5531

1 Input
2 Outputs
  • 57a74b3bd2c431f89c65d30dab8a51df3d8ce5103bce7b70c04ecdcd424f5531:0
  • value  371746
    address  32RMvjY8RoLXY4AFHrr7F4JHuv3kPhG2mA
  • 57a74b3bd2c431f89c65d30dab8a51df3d8ce5103bce7b70c04ecdcd424f5531:1
  • value  3784592
    address  1LD5Qo1CBq7YN5tRESRmsYdfM9fLwergGy